Studies at Saguaro National Park and elsewhere have demonstrated that saguaro growth – and thus the age to reproduction – is closely tied to summer precipitation (Drezner 2008). Arizona’s monsoon rains tend to occur reliably, typically from about June 15 to September 30, but the amount of rain varies both locally and regionally.

How do saguaros grow? A. Saguaros are a very slow growing cactus. In Saguaro National Park, studies indicate that a saguaro grows between 1 and 1.5 inches in the first eight years of its life. Q. The jury is still out on whether this one really counts as a hike or not - but another one of the easiest trails in Saguaro National Park, the Signal Hill trail, leads to some stunning 800-year-old petroglyphs on broken rocks that are a must-see.The East district is much larger than the West. Saguaro National Park East is 67,476 acres. This side has an older saguaro forest, higher elevations, oak woodland, and pine forests. Saguaro National Park West is 25,391 acres. This side has a higher saguaro density, younger saguaro forest, and lower elevation.The ideal time to go to Saguaro National Park is during the spring months of March to May, when the park is in full bloom.
